Internet Security

Network Security Toolkit Pros And Cons

When it comes to network security, businesses and individuals are often on the lookout for reliable tools to protect their sensitive data. One such tool is the Network Security Toolkit (NST), which offers a range of pros and cons worth considering. With the increasing number of cybersecurity threats in today's digital landscape, it's essential to understand the benefits and limitations of NST to make informed decisions to safeguard networks.

Diving into the pros and cons of Network Security Toolkit, it's important to note that NST has a strong foundation in open-source software. This means that it benefits from a community of developers who continuously contribute to its improvement. Additionally, NST offers a wide range of powerful security tools like Wireshark, Nmap, and Snort, allowing for comprehensive network monitoring and threat detection. However, one potential drawback is that NST might have a steeper learning curve for beginners, as it requires a certain level of technical knowledge to effectively utilize its features. Despite this, NST remains a valuable asset for those seeking robust network security solutions.



Network Security Toolkit Pros And Cons

Introduction to Network Security Toolkit

Network Security Toolkit (NST) is a specialized Linux distribution that provides a comprehensive set of open-source tools for network security analysis, monitoring, and defense. It is designed to be used by network administrators, security professionals, and individuals who want to enhance the security of their networks.

NST is based on Fedora and features a collection of powerful tools such as Wireshark, Nmap, Snort, Metasploit, and many others. These tools enable users to perform various tasks related to network security, including network traffic analysis, vulnerability scanning, intrusion detection, and penetration testing.

Like any other tool or software, the Network Security Toolkit has its pros and cons. In this article, we will explore the advantages and disadvantages of using NST in a network security environment.

Pros of Network Security Toolkit

1. Wide Range of Powerful Security Tools

One of the major advantages of using NST is that it provides a wide range of powerful security tools that can be utilized for various network security tasks. These tools are carefully selected and integrated into the distribution, ensuring that users have access to the best tools available in the industry.

From packet analyzers to vulnerability scanners and from intrusion detection systems to penetration testing frameworks, NST offers a comprehensive suite of tools that can help network administrators and security professionals identify vulnerabilities, monitor network traffic, detect malicious activities, and implement effective security measures.

Moreover, NST regularly updates its toolset to include the latest versions and security patches, ensuring that users have access to the most up-to-date and secure tools in the ever-evolving field of network security.

2. Easy-to-Use and User-Friendly Interface

Another advantage of NST is its easy-to-use and user-friendly interface. The distribution is designed with a focus on usability, making it accessible even to users with limited experience in network security.

The graphical user interface (GUI) of NST provides a centralized platform for accessing and managing the various security tools. The interface is well-organized, intuitive, and offers convenient navigation, allowing users to quickly locate the tools they need and perform the desired tasks without any hassle.

Additionally, NST provides detailed documentation and tutorials to help users understand the functionalities of the tools and make the most of them. This comprehensive documentation enables users to effectively utilize the security tools and enhance their network security posture.

3. Customizability and Flexibility

NST offers a high level of customizability and flexibility, allowing users to tailor the distribution according to their specific requirements and preferences. The modular nature of NST enables users to add or remove tools, configure settings, and customize various aspects of the distribution.

Users can create their own customized toolkit by selecting the necessary tools and removing any unnecessary ones, ensuring that the distribution meets their specific needs. This flexibility makes NST a versatile solution that can be adapted to different network environments, whether it be a small-scale local network or a large enterprise network.

Furthermore, NST supports virtualization, allowing users to run the distribution as a virtual machine. This capability provides additional flexibility, as users can deploy NST on existing virtualization platforms and easily integrate it into their network infrastructure.

4. Strong Community Support

NST has a strong and active community of users and developers who contribute to its development, support, and improvement. The community provides forums, mailing lists, and online resources where users can seek assistance, share knowledge, and collaborate with other security professionals.

This vibrant community ensures that NST remains up-to-date, secure, and responsive to emerging threats and challenges in the field of network security. Users can benefit from the collective expertise and experience of the community, making NST an even more valuable tool for network security.

Moreover, the community actively encourages user feedback and suggestions for enhancements, which helps in shaping the future development of NST and ensuring that it continues to meet the evolving needs of users.

Cons of Network Security Toolkit

1. Steep Learning Curve

Although NST aims to be user-friendly, it still has a steep learning curve, especially for users who are new to network security and Linux-based distributions. The vast array of tools and the complexities associated with their configuration and utilization may require significant time and effort to master.

New users might need to invest time in understanding the functionalities of different tools, configuring the distribution to suit their needs, and familiarizing themselves with the Linux command line interface. This learning process can be challenging for beginners and may require additional training or support.

However, once users overcome the initial learning curve and gain proficiency in using NST, they can harness the full potential of its security tools and benefit from its advanced capabilities.

2. Resource Intensive

Another drawback of NST is that it can be resource-intensive, requiring relatively high system specifications to run smoothly and efficiently. The extensive toolset and functionality of NST demand a significant amount of processing power, memory, and storage space.

Network administrators planning to deploy NST should ensure that their systems meet the recommended requirements to avoid performance issues and ensure optimal performance. Insufficient system resources may result in slower performance, lag, or unresponsiveness, hampering the effectiveness of the network security tasks performed using NST.

However, with the availability of modern hardware and virtualization technologies, this limitation can be mitigated by allocating adequate resources to the NST environment.

3. Limited Vendor Support

As an open-source distribution, NST does not enjoy the same level of vendor support as commercial networking solutions. The absence of dedicated vendor support means that users may face challenges in getting specific issues resolved or receiving timely assistance for complex technical problems.

However, the active community support and extensive online resources available for NST help mitigate this drawback to a certain extent. Users can rely on the collective expertise of the community and seek assistance from fellow users, although it may not be as streamlined as having dedicated vendor support.

For critical or specialized network security requirements, organizations may consider involving professional support services or opting for commercial network security solutions that offer dedicated vendor support.

Exploring Network Security Toolkit Further

Another aspect of Network Security Toolkit that deserves attention is its compatibility with different network architectures and its ability to handle diverse security challenges.

Flexible Deployment Options

One of the highlights of Network Security Toolkit is its flexibility in deployment. NST can be utilized in various network architectures, including small local networks, enterprise environments, and cloud-based infrastructures.

The modular design of NST allows it to be easily integrated into existing network infrastructures and complement existing security measures. It can be deployed as a standalone security solution or as part of a larger network security ecosystem.

Furthermore, NST supports virtualization technologies, enabling users to run it as a virtual machine on popular hypervisors such as VMware or VirtualBox. This deployment option provides additional flexibility and scalability, allowing users to allocate resources dynamically and easily replicate and manage multiple NST instances.

Network Security Toolkit for Different Security Challenges

The wide range of security tools available in NST makes it suitable for addressing various security challenges and scenarios. Whether it's network monitoring, vulnerability management, or incident response, NST offers the necessary capabilities to handle diverse security requirements.

For example:

  • The packet sniffing and analysis tools in NST, such as Wireshark and tcpdump, assist in monitoring network traffic and identifying packet-level anomalies.
  • The vulnerability scanning tools, including OpenVAS and Nexpose, help identify weaknesses and vulnerabilities in network infrastructure.
  • Network intrusion detection and prevention systems like Snort and Suricata aid in detecting and preventing network intrusions and malicious activities.
  • The penetration testing frameworks such as Metasploit and Nmap assist in evaluating the security posture of network systems, identifying potential vulnerabilities, and testing the effectiveness of existing security controls.

These examples illustrate the versatility of NST in addressing various network security challenges and emphasize its usefulness as a comprehensive toolkit for network security professionals.

Conclusion

Network Security Toolkit (NST) is a powerful Linux distribution that offers a wide range of open-source security tools for network analysis, monitoring, and defense. It provides several benefits, including access to powerful security tools, a user-friendly interface, customizability, and strong community support.

However, it also has certain drawbacks, such as a steep learning curve, resource-intensive requirements, and limited vendor support. Despite these limitations, NST remains a valuable tool for network security professionals and administrators, helping them enhance the security of their networks and protect against potential threats.

The flexibility and compatibility of NST with different network architectures, its ability to handle diverse security challenges, and its extensive toolset make it a comprehensive solution for network security practitioners. Whether it's monitoring network traffic, identifying vulnerabilities, detecting intrusions, or conducting penetration tests, NST offers the necessary tools and functionalities to address a wide range of network security needs.



Pros and Cons of Network Security Toolkit

The Network Security Toolkit (NST) is a powerful open-source toolkit that provides a wide range of tools and resources for network security professionals. It offers several advantages:

  • Comprehensive toolkit: NST includes a variety of tools, such as network packet capture and analysis, intrusion detection and prevention, vulnerability scanning, and network monitoring. This all-in-one solution saves time and effort for professionals.
  • Easy to use: NST is designed with a user-friendly interface, making it accessible for both beginners and experienced professionals. It provides detailed documentation and tutorials to assist users in mastering the toolkit quickly.
  • Flexibility: NST can be used as a standalone system or run as a virtual machine. It supports various operating systems and architectures, allowing professionals to customize and adapt the toolkit to their specific needs.

However, there are a few limitations to consider:

  • Complexity: Some tools in NST may require advanced technical knowledge to utilize effectively. Beginners may find it challenging to navigate and utilize the full potential of the toolkit.
  • Resource-intensive: Running NST may require significant system resources, such as CPU, memory, and disk space. Professionals should ensure they have adequate resources available to run the toolkit smoothly.
  • Continuous updates: As network security threats evolve, it's crucial to keep NST updated with the most recent security patches and tool updates. Regular maintenance and updates are essential to ensure the toolkit remains effective against emerging threats.

Key Takeaways: Network Security Toolkit Pros and Cons

  • 1. Network Security Toolkit (NST) is a powerful tool for network diagnostics and security assessment.
  • 2. NST provides a wide range of security tools and utilities, making it a comprehensive solution for network security.
  • 3. One of the main advantages of NST is its ease of use and user-friendly interface.
  • 4. NST supports a variety of network protocols and can be used for both wired and wireless networks.
  • 5. However, NST requires some technical knowledge and expertise to fully utilize its capabilities.

Frequently Asked Questions

Welcome to our Frequently Asked Questions section on Network Security Toolkit (NST) pros and cons. Here, we will address some common queries related to NST and its advantages and disadvantages. Whether you are considering implementing NST in your network security strategy or looking to gain more insights about its benefits and limitations, you will find the answers you need below.

1. What are the pros of using Network Security Toolkit?

Network Security Toolkit offers several advantages that make it a popular choice among network security professionals:

First, NST is a comprehensive all-in-one package that includes a wide range of security tools, making it convenient for users to perform various security tasks from a single platform. Additionally, NST is free and open-source, enabling cost-effective implementation without compromising on functionality.

2. What are the potential drawbacks of Network Security Toolkit?

While NST offers numerous advantages, it's essential to be aware of the potential drawbacks:

One limitation of NST is the learning curve associated with its usage. As the toolkit includes a plethora of tools, users may require some time and effort to familiarize themselves with all the features and functionalities. Additionally, as an open-source tool, NST may have limited support compared to commercial solutions in terms of ongoing updates and dedicated technical assistance.

3. Can NST be integrated into existing network security infrastructure?

Yes, Network Security Toolkit can be seamlessly integrated into existing network security infrastructure. NST is designed to be compatible with various network security devices and platforms, offering the flexibility to incorporate it into your network environment without major disruptions. It can complement and enhance your existing security measures, providing additional layers of protection.

4. Is Network Security Toolkit suitable for all organizations?

While Network Security Toolkit is a versatile tool, its suitability may vary depending on the specific needs and requirements of each organization. Small to medium-sized enterprises, educational institutions, and non-profit organizations often find NST particularly beneficial due to its cost-effectiveness and comprehensive feature set. However, larger organizations with more complex network security setups may require additional customization and support that might not be readily available with NST.

5. How does Network Security Toolkit compare to other network security solutions?

Network Security Toolkit offers a unique combination of advantages and disadvantages compared to other network security solutions:

On the positive side, NST provides a cost-effective alternative to commercial security solutions without compromising on functionality. It offers a wide range of tools in one package, simplifying the management and utilization of security resources. However, as an open-source tool, NST may have less comprehensive ongoing support and advanced features compared to commercial solutions that come with dedicated support teams and advanced customization options.



In summary, the Network Security Toolkit (NST) has several pros and cons. On the positive side, the NST offers a wide range of powerful security tools that can help safeguard networks against threats. It provides a comprehensive suite of applications that can be easily accessed and used through a user-friendly interface.

However, the use of the NST also has its drawbacks. Firstly, the installation and configuration process can be complex and time-consuming, requiring technical expertise. Additionally, the NST may not be suitable for all network environments, as it may not support certain hardware or software configurations.


Recent Post